640, RE: Converting Auto to Manual Posted by mcgyvr, Dec-31-69 06:00 PM
4 cylinder Automatic to 5-speed conversion
Parts that will be needed:
5-speed Shifter Shifter linkage Modular Clutch Clutch Master Cylinder Clutch Slave Cylinder New Hydolic Clutch Lines Recommended Transmission (from A/S/nt talon/eclipse or 95-99 neon more modifications if neon transmission is used.) Rear tranny mount Brake pedal and linkage Clutch pedal and linkage Same year 5spd ECU (ATX ECU’s have a low rev limiter)
Hurdles that need to be overcome:
Wiring for reverse lights Wiring for ECU Wiring for Speedo to work

659, RE: Converting Auto to Manual Posted by daltah, Dec-31-69 06:00 PM
You dont need the exact year manul ecu.As long as you car is 96-99 all you need is a manual ecu from a 96-99 talon/eclipse/avenger.In 95 the ecu was programed for all the emessions requirements so it will through stuff off and turn you check engine light on too.Also the tranny from a 4cylinder avenger will work also.

685, RE: Converting Auto to Manual Posted by mcgyvr, Dec-31-69 06:00 PM
its best to get the ECU from your year as there are some wiring differences vs each year.
and in that list is the avenger tranny thats the A/S/nt eclipse thats avenger/sebring/nt eclipse
